Hopefully others correct me if I am wrong, but I feel that unless you do wireless scanning, you cannot ensure that you 
don't have a rogue AP up in your network.

As a note, it might help to know what you mean by rogue AP. There are two typical uses for this and which one you mean 
might change your responses:

1) Do you mean detecting any wireless networks put up by your users and you currently do not have a wireless network? 
(not too hard)

2) Do you want to detect rogue APs that are masquerading as your AP? (more difficult)
